Mutable Default Arguments

Open ruddyscent opened this issue 1 year ago • 0 comments

The constructor of the Graph class has [] as the default value for the vertices parameter. However, this implementation would fail the following test code.

class TestGraph(unittest.TestCase):
    def setUp(self):
        self.graph = Graph()

    def test_add_vertex(self):
        self.assertEqual(self.graph.vertex_count, 0)

    def test_remove_vertex(self):
        self.graph.add_vertex('A')
        self.graph.add_vertex('B')
        self.graph.add_vertex('C')
        self.assertEqual(self.graph.vertex_count, 3)

The reason for this issue is explained in detail in the following link:

Mutable Default Arguments - Python Guide
